[Q] Going from Jelly Bean to GingerBread

I need help im tired of jellybean. Theres too many things not working for me and i want to go back to GingerBread. I try to flash GingerBread roms but it just brings me back to CWM recovery. Is there a way to go back or im stuck on jellybean. I even tried to flash an Icecream Sandwich rom but it just brings me back to CWM recovery. My recovery is 6.0.2.8.
You probably should just one-click to stock and start from there.
Sent from my SGH-T959V using xda premium
I don't think you can downgrade from an mtd ROM if you were using one. I think you will have to return to the stock 2.3.6 first, and then flash another ROM if you would like.
